They hit the final tape.
Coupeville High School track and field athletes wrapped their season — and the run of spring awards banquets — Thursday night.
Following on the heels of softball, baseball, and girls’ tennis, the school’s largest spring sports squad handed out varsity letters and participation certificates.
CHS coaches, led by Elizabeth Bitting and Bob Martin, also honored Erica McGrath and Hank Milnes as four-year athletes and hailed the 18 Wolves who went to state.
